Imagine turning your pain into punchlines. That's exactly what comedian Christian Cintron does, and he’s here to share how humor can be a powerful tool for healing. In this episode, Christian opens up about his journey through comedy, touching on his mixed heritage and the challenges of not feeling fully connected to any one group. He dives deep into how trauma and pain have shaped his comedic voice, making his jokes not just funny, but profoundly impactful.

Christian’s unique 'Stand Up for Your Power' class is more than just a comedy workshop. It’s a transformative experience that helps students process their trauma, assert themselves, and discover their inner strength—all through the lens of humor. He believes that comedy comes from tension and discomfort, but on the other side of that is immense power. By using humor to set boundaries and speak up, Christian teaches his students to turn their struggles into strengths.

What sets Christian apart is his incorporation of psychedelics and plant medicine into his comedy practice. He shares how these substances have expanded his awareness and brought a new depth to his performances. For Christian, comedy is not just an act; it's a state of non-ordinary consciousness that allows for profound self-expression and healing.
